_Climatic and Geographical Effects of Surface and Underground Draining._
I have commenced this chapter with a description of the dikes and other
hydraulic works of the Netherland engineers, because the geographical
results of such operations are more obvious and more easily measured,
though certainly not more important, than those of the older and more
widely diffused modes of resisting or directing the flow of waters,
which have been practised from remote antiquity in the interior of all
civilized countries. Draining and irrigation are habitually regarded as
purely agricultural processes, having little or no relation to technical
geography; but we shall find that they exert a powerful influence on
soil, climate, and animal and vegetable life, and may, therefore, justly
claim to be regarded as geographical elements.
_Surface and Under-draining and their Effects._
Superficial draining is a necessity in all lands newly reclaimed from
the forest. The face of the ground in the woods is never so regularly
inclined as to permit water to flow freely over it. There are, even on
the hillsides, many small ridges and depressions, partly belonging to
the original distribution of the soil, and partly occasioned by
irregularities in the growth and deposit of vegetable matter. These, in
the husbandry of nature, serve as dams and reservoirs to collect a
larger supply of moisture than the spongy earth can at once imbibe.
Besides this, the vegetable mould is, even under the most favorable
circumstances, slow in parting with the humidity it has accumulated
under the protection of the woods, and the infiltration from neighboring
forests contributes to keep the soil of small clearings too wet for the
advantageous cultivation of artificial crops. For these reasons, surface
draining must have commenced with agriculture itself, and there is
probably no cultivated district, one may almost say no single field,
which is not provided with artificial arrangements for facilitating the
escape of superficial water, and thus carrying off moisture which, in
the natural condition of the earth, would have been imbibed by the soil.
The beneficial effects of surface drainage, the necessity of extending
the fields as population increased, and the inconveniences resulting
from the presence of marshes in otherwise improved regions, must have
suggested at a very early period of human industry the expediency of
converting bogs and swamps into dry land by drawing off their waters;
and it would not be long after the introduction of this practice before
further acquisition of agricultural territory would be made by lowering
the outlet of small ponds and lakes, and adding the ground they covered
to the domain of the husbandman.
